Outline of Final Research Achievements

Patients with childhood acute lymphoblastic leukemia (ALL) in high risk recur about 30%. Recently, IKZF1 alteration in genomic DNA has been found as a prognostic factor. To elucidate the role of the IKZF1 alteration, we developed childhood ALL model cells with IKZF1 mutations. We investigated the relationship between the IKZF1 alteration and anti-cancer drug sensitivity which are frequently used in childhood ALL. The results showed the sensitivity to the several drugs may be dependent on the IKZF1 alteration.
